    I've just release a beta of a free, semi-automatic directory submission tool called SliQ Submitter.

    The tool is totally free and currently handles about 450 directories which have all been checked to make sure they work. The tool automatically completes fields in directory submission forms - with the exception of the CAPTCHA fields.

    You can specify up to 5 titles and descriptions and up to 6 categories to try and match when submitting.

    SliQ Submitter is a semi-automatic directory submission tool. You still have to manually verify categories, titles and descriptions and so on. It just makes the whole process of submission much quicker. When you load a directory submit page, SliQ Submitter fills in the fields for you so you don't have to copy and paste.

    I am always in a search for a GOOD PROFESSIONAL directory submitter

    While the softie has A GREAT category SELECTOR and good potential

    here is my suggestions for improvement

    1. being able to EASILY add / delete directories (many of you directories are already PAID, how does one delete them ???)

    2. TABBED submission in order to be able to save time

    3. more options NOT only visited (submitted, skipped, unavailable etc)

    4. more titles/description should be allowed

    5. some basic directory database manipulation/sorting (more fields, category of directory etc)

    6. shortcuts (reconfigurable if possible) for doing repetitive tasks FAST

    if you make all these improvement I personally would be willing to pay for it
    since I am very impressed with the CATEGORY SELECTOR (have not seen it anywhere)
